Introduction

Plates storage is an essential aspect of kitchen organization that can greatly enhance your cooking and dining experience. Proper plates storage not only keeps your dishes safe from chips and scratches but also makes it easier to access them when needed. There are various methods to store plates effectively, including stackable designs, plate racks, and dedicated cabinets.

When considering plates storage, it's important to think about the space you have available and the types of plates you own. Here are some tips to optimize your plates storage:
  • Use Stackable Storage: Stackable plate organizers allow you to save space while keeping your plates neatly arranged.
  • Consider Plate Racks: Plate racks can be a stylish way to display your plates while keeping them easily accessible.
  • Utilize Cabinets Wisely: Designate specific cabinets for plate storage to keep them organized and out of the way.
  • Protect Your Plates: Use felt or cork pads between stacked plates to prevent scratching.
  • Regularly Assess Your Storage: Periodically review your plates storage to ensure it meets your current needs and make adjustments as necessary.
By implementing effective plates storage solutions, you can enjoy a more organized kitchen and protect your valuable dinnerware for years to come.

FAQs

How can I choose the best plates storage solution for my needs?

Consider your available space, the number of plates you have, and whether you prefer easy access or aesthetic display. Stackable organizers and plate racks are popular options.

What are the key features to look for when selecting plates storage?

Look for durability, capacity, ease of access, and protection features to prevent damage to your plates.

Are there any common mistakes people make when storing plates?

Yes, common mistakes include stacking plates too high without protection, not using organizers, and neglecting to regularly assess storage needs.

How can I protect my plates while in storage?

Use felt or cork pads between stacked plates and avoid overcrowding to minimize the risk of chips and scratches.

What types of plates can benefit from proper storage solutions?

All types of plates, including dinner plates, dessert plates, and specialty plates, can benefit from proper storage to maintain their condition.
